Try:

if(!parent.frame_name){
  location.href="frames_page.htm"
}

frame_name :  the main frameset
frames_page:  the frameset page

> I have a frames site but want to avoid visitors landing on any page except
> the front splash page...
>
> Is there a way I can ensure that when a visitor lands on any page (after
> using a search engine),  that it automatically detects that he/she should
> have been in a frames site and then redirects them to the front page?  I
> don't want to put a "click here if you didn't land on the front page" link
> on every page.
